recyclable
adjEtymology
From recycle + -able.
- derived from *kʷékʷlos✻
- derived from κύκλος
- derived from cyclus
Definitions
Able to be recycled.
- Soda cans are recyclable.
- People are reminded again, as before, please do not leave plastic bottles, milk containers or otherwise at the Bring Centre – there are no plastic containers there any longer for such recyclable materials.
An object that can be recycled, such as a soda can.
- The garbage and recyclables need to be taken out to the street tomorrow.
- A pull-out trash drawer gives you a place to hide kitchen waste and recyclables.
